First test drive: noticed the lag from standstill like u all said. Engine sound ok tho. Not as noisy for me la. Overall ok but not satisfied enough cos da road kinda jam that day. Cannot really test to the fullest. Lol.

Second test drive: diff showroom. Near to kuching airport. So got many straight road. Can accelerate up to 140-150kmh. Stable and car really stick to the road. One problem though. Gf was sitting behind and noticed the wind noise is loud but SA ensured us that it only happen to this particular unit. Wan to trust him on this matter. Since i got free time, i tested inspira 2.0 too. Somehow i like preve better than inspira after i finish my session with both cars.

Really feel like getting one. biggrin.gif
